Output c32704ef6e2ea0bf2e312622da9962b3023ed64a0d14f052f4e36fdf04650e92:20

value
64477996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341c687abf472ea812c928f2621185d5bbc6b1dd OP_EQUAL
address
MCehQEfMrxMDwfxMu7rn8bSmozWKJ4ZQQC
transaction
c32704ef6e2ea0bf2e312622da9962b3023ed64a0d14f052f4e36fdf04650e92
spent
true